I think Twitter is best described as "Micro-blogging". You make small 140 character or less blog posts throughout the day. These micro-blog posts are called tweets.
Since the posts are so short, they are meant to convey small thoughts or what you are doing right that moment.
People follow you and when you post something it is automatically "pushed" to their twitter account and they get a notification. You follow people (like MckMama) and get her updates pushed to you.
You can post to your twitter account in 3 main ways:
- Your phone (via a text message or twitter program if you have a smart phone)
- via the website twitter.com
- Through a program that you install on your computer called a "twitter client". There are many popular twitter clients like thwirl and twitteriffic.
You can reply to someone by including the @ symbol followed by their username in your post, eg. @mckmama.
